The operations defined by the osi model are conceptual and not unique to any particular network protocol suite. So, in a sense, the osi model is sort of a standards standard. Two similar projects from the late 1970s were merged in 1983 to form the. Here are the basic functionalities of the application layer. Layer 4 of the open systems interconnection osi reference model. Osi model the application layer the application layer layer 7 provides. First, you want to communicate with your nighbour system, you need a physical connection. The transport layer is responsible for providing reliable transport services to the upperlayer protocols. The application layer of the tcpip model is used to handle all processtoprocess communication functions. Upper layer protocols do not always fit perfectly within a layer, and often function across multiple layers. Multiplexing for combining data from several sources for transmission over one data path.
This model has been criticized because of its technicality and limited features. Actual communication is defined by various communication protocols. The world wide web www is a system realized at the application layer of the osi. Each layer has a different but specific processing. Q6 which layer of the osi model contains the llc sub layer and the mac sub layer. The function of the upper layers of the osi model can be difficult to visualize. Osi layers free download as powerpoint presentation. If you merge all 7 layers into 1 the process will remain same but it will become very complicated to implement, troubleshoot etc. An example of an osi model network layer protocol is the x. Osi model the application layer the application layer layer7 provides the interface between the user application and the network. Protocols at each osi layers what is osi model osi model open systems interconnection is a standardised reference framework for conceptualising data communications between networks the seven layers of osi model are generally divided into two groups.
Service definitions, like the osi model, abstractly describe the functionality provided to an nlayer by an n1 layer, where n is one of the seven layers of protocols operating in the local host. Its goal is the interoperability of diverse communication systems with standard protocols. Ans data is transported in bits at the physical layer. Osi layer and network protocol linkedin slideshare. A single layer could interface with multiple upper or lower layer protocols using the same interface. Advice upper layer person or software layer sales heart of osi take not lower layer do or hardware layer please.
It conceptually divides computer network architecture into 7 layers in a logical progression. Osi model defines a networking framework to implement protocols in seven layers. It partitions organize correspondence into seven layers. The open systems interconnection osi model is a reference tool for understanding data communications between any two networked systems. Layer 3, the network layer of the osi model, provides an endtoend logical addressing system so that a packet of data can be routed across several layer 2 networks ethernet,token ring, frame relay, etc. Apr 21, 2016 a s we talked earlier in the article osi model and its 7 layers, the network layer becomes one of the most important layers of the osi model because it applies some concepts which define the base. This layer is available in the form of software on a laptop, computer, mobile, etc. Network architecture provides only a conceptual framework for communications between computers.
Layers in the osi model of a computer network dummies. Download amcat osi, tcpip layers and protocols questions 2020. There are so many functions that need to be performed to be able to interwork different systems, a structure is required to be able to categorize and separate functions, so that it is possible to discuss separate issues separately and not mix things up. The osi model specifies what aspects of a networks operation can be addressed by various network standards. Note that network layer addresses can also be referred to as logical addresses. Q7 how can data be transported in different layers. A tutorial on the open systems interconnection networking reference model. This study guide compares the different layers of the osi. Layer7 application layer layer6 presentation layer layer5 session layer protocols that operate at these layers manage applicationlevel functions, and are generally implemented in software. The transport layer is responsible for providing reliable transport services to the upper layer protocols. Unlike other layers of the osi reference model, the datalink layer is made up of two sub layers. The open systems interconnection osi reference model is a descriptive network scheme. The core functions of application layer is given below. Nov 21, 2016 this is called a model for open system interconnection osi and is commonly known as osi model.
The open systems interconnection osi model isoiec 74981 is a product of the open systems interconnection effort at the international organization for standa rdization, it w as provided by the. It is important to remember the order of the layers in the osi model. Other protocols at this layer include gopher, nfs, ntp, x. The protocol layers of the osi reference model are traditionally listed from the top layer. The osi layers are not to be found in the scada world, or anywhere else outside college or a textbook. In 1977 the iso model was introduced, which consisted of seven different layers. Includes protocols for tasks such as transferring files, sending emails, and saving data to network servers. The protocol used by this layer are icmp, ip, arp, dhcp etc. It does not provide services to any other osi layer.
In this tutorial, we will take an indepth look at the functionality of each layer. The remainder of this article describes each layer, starting from the bottom, and explains some of the devices and protocols you might expect to find in your data centre operating at this layer. Illustrated overview of all the functions required for communications, and protocols vs. The model itself does not provide specific methods of communication. The osi model defines conceptual operations that are not unique to any particular network protocol suite. The result of this standardization will provide a standard data model, communications protocol and management functional areas that are. The open system interconnection osi model also defines a logical network and effectively describes computer packet transfer by using various layers of protocols.
Layers 14 are viewed as the lower layers, and for the most part fret about moving information around. The function of each layer should be chosen according to the internationally standardized protocols. Communication protocols, rpc computer science division department of electrical engineering and computer sciences university of california, berkeley berkeley, ca 947201776 iso osi reference model for layers application presentation session transport network datalink physical mapping layers onto routers and hosts lower three layers are. The osi model is a logical and conceptual model that defines network communication used by systems open to interconnection and communication with other systems. Aug 30, 2019 osi protocols are a family of standards for information exchange. Notice that the bottom layer is identified as the first layer.
Layer 47 services, sometimes referred to as the upper layers, support endtoend communication between a source and destination application and are used whenever a message passes. Osi model the upper layers the top three layers of the osi model are often referred to as the upper layers. It defines seven layers or levels in a complete communication system. Osi model layers and its functions electrical academia. Figure 2 shows some of the important internet protocols and their relationship to the osi reference model. A protocol in the networking terms is a kind of negotiation and.
Osi and tcpip model layers osi and tcpip model layers. On an ethernet network, the data link layer is referencing the mac addresses that are communicating on the network. Osi model layers and protocols pdf this article is about network protocols organized by osi model. A company could now mix and match network devices and protocols. The logical link control llc sublayer controls access to the physical layer and allows multiple protocols to access the network simultaneously. Wan protocols operate at the lowest three layers of the osi model and define communication over the various widearea media. Osi model 7 layers explained pdf layers functions what is osi model. Osi model was developed by the international organization for. It is responsible for transmitting data to the physical layer. Presentation application session transport network data link physical layer 7 layer 6 layer 5 layer 4 layer 3 layer 2 layer 1.
The user application itself does not reside at the application layer the protocol does. From the topic osi, tcpip layers and protocols, mostly 2 to 3 questions come. The layers represent data transfer operations common to all types of data transfers among cooperating networks. Layer 4 through layer 7 are services delivered by the upper layers of the open systems interconnection osi communication model. For wans, data link layer protocols encapsulate lan traffic into frames suitable. Big picture of communication over network is understandable through this osi model.
Osi model layers explained learn with theleanprogrammer. The number of layers should be large enough that distinct. Application layer supports application, apps, and enduser processes. Advantage of dividing the osi reference model in layers.
The open systems interconnection osi model defines a networking framework to implement protocols in layers, with control passed from one layer to the next. The seven layers of osi model their protocols and functions. A complete guide to open systems interconnection model osi model. This article lists protocols, categorized by the nearest layer in the open systems interconnection model. Layer14 are called media layers or lower layers layer57 are called upper layers or. Data encoding method of converting a stream of data bits into. Why layers, because those components follow a proper order of execution. The major protocols used by this layer include bluetooth, pon, otn, dsl, ieee. At which osi layer does the rip protocol operate in.
The application layer is the top most layer of osi model, and it provides that directly support user applications such as database access. This layer works at the client or user side which is shown below. Model the osi reference model is composed of seven layers, each specifying particular network functions. What are the protocols for the different layers of the osi. Apr 14, 2018 the osi model breaks down this data transfercommunication procedure into different components called layers. In 1977, the international organization for standardization iso, began to develop its open systems interconnection osi networking suite. The result of this standardization will provide a standard data model, communications protocol and management functional areas that are applicable to osi and non osi applications. Ccna certificationthe osi model wikibooks, open books for. It divides the communications processes into seven layers. For information on the osi reference model and the role of each layer, please refer to the document internetworking basics. A web browser and an email client are examples of user applications. Osi layers internet protocol suite osi model scribd. The application layer is the highest layer in the tcpip model and is related to the session, presentation and application layers of the osi model.
Chapter 1 introduction to networking and the osi model. Rather, the osi model is a framework into which the various networking standards can fit. The following are the osi protocols used in the seven layers of the osi model. Osi layer 7 is the application layer, depicted in figure 8. Osi stands for open system interconnection is a reference model that describes how information from a software application in one computer moves through a physical medium to the software application in another computer osi consists of seven layers, and each layer performs a particular network function. Routing protocols are network layer protocols that are responsible for exchanging information between routers so that the routers can select the proper path for network traffic. The application layer is the layer nearest to the user and provides services to applications used by the endpoint devices. The number of layers should be large enough that distinct functions should not be put in the same layer and small. The osi model describes network activities as having a structure of seven layers, each of which has one or more protocols associated with it.
Here, data are formatted in a schema that the network can understand, with the format varying according to the type of network used. Protocol encapsulation chart a pdf file illustrating the relationship between common. Protocol layers and the osi model system administration. A protocol in the context of networking is essentially a system of rules which define how data is transferred from a source to a destination, at different levels of abstraction from the physical level of electrical pulses carried via cables or wireless, or fibreoptical signals, to the more abstract level of messages sent by an application such as email. However, the various computer networking teaching sources contain much disagreement, if not outrightargument, aboutwhichosilayerdescribes.
The osi model is a layered framework for the design of network systems that allows for communication across all types of computer systems. Electrical, mechanical, functional, and procedural specifications are provided for sending a bit stream on a computer network. The osi model open system interconnection model defines a computer networking framework to implement protocols in seven layers. Wikipedia actually has a nice graphic that shows where some of the various layers are situated. The application layer is also called as the layer 7 of the osi model. Eigrp and ospf are not considered application layer protocols, rather they are network layer protocols since they are respectively using ip protocol 88 and ip protocol 89 to communicate, you can refer the ipv4 header diagram and check the details of protocol field where there is dedicated port under the protocol field for each layer 3 protocol. A protocol in the networking terms is a kind of negotiation and rule in between two networking entities.
The application layer is the last layer of the osi model. Study flashcards on osi model layers, function, hardware, protocols and standards at. We commonly think of the data link layer as having data link control protocols. The osi open systems interconnection reference model defines seven layers of networking protocols. Service definitions, like the osi model, abstractly describe the functionality provided to an n layer by an n1 layer, where n is one of the seven layers of protocols. The osi layers and protocol stacks networking course youtube.
This layer deals with the hardware of networks such as cabling. Presentation application session transport network data link physical layer 7 layer 6 layer 5 layer 4 layer 3 layer 2 layer. Layers can be added and removed without needing any changes to the code for individual layers. Provide user interface to send and receive the data. Ip provides an unreliable, connectionless datagram delivery service, which means that ip does not guarantee that an ip datagram successfully reaches its destination. Theoretically each layer should be independent of all others, but this is a simplistic notion and one of the reasons of osi model demise. The osi model isnt itself a networking standard in the same sense that ethernet and tcpip are. Each layer provides specific services and makes the results available to the next layer. A layer should be created where different level of abstraction is needed. Other network protocols, such as sna, add an eighth layer. Each layer both performs specific functions to support the layers above it and offers services to the layers below it. For example, the osi network protocol suite implements all seven layers of the osi reference model.
Tcpip uses some of osi model layers and combines others. Osi model and protocols in each layer pdf this article is about network protocols organized by osi model. The physical layer of the osi model defines connector and interface specifications, as well as the medium cable requirements. Multiplexing is the method of combining data from the upper layers and. These were developed and designed by the international organization of standardization iso.
Layers 57, the upper layers, contain applicationlevel information. Pdf the osi model and network protocols emma greening. The 7 layers of the osi model webopedia study guide. Mapping network protocols to layers of the osi model. I need more clarity on what the application name which rip uses is. The complexity of these layers is beyond the scope of this tutorial. Osi model 7 layers explained pdf layers functions the open systems interconnection model osi model is a conceptual model that characterizes and standardizes the communication functions of a telecommunication or computing system without regard to their underlying internal structure and technology. The international standards organization iso built up the open systems interconnection osi display. Figure 1 shows the tcpip protocol suite in relation to the osi reference model. This is the layer that the enduser can be a computer programmer, or a regular pc user is actually interacting with. It is now considered the primary architectural model for intercomputer communications. Tcpip has its own reference model which in fact predates osi.
Communication protocols enable an entity in one host to interact with a corresponding entity at the same layer in another host. Application, presentation, session, transport, network, data link and physical in detail along with their functions. This list is not exclusive to only the osi protocol family. Layer 1 layer 1 is the physical layer and, under the osi model, defines the physical and electrical characteristics of the network. Many of these protocols are originally based on the internet protocol suite tcpip and other models and they often do not fit neatly into osi layers. The osi reference model the model was developed by the international organisation for standardisation iso in 1984. Each layer provides a service to the layer above it in the protocol specification. Categorized by their nearest open systems interconnection osi model layers. This is the most fundamental communication that occurs across our network. The osi open system interconnection reference model is the comprehensive set of standards and rules for hardware manufacturers and software developers. The user interacts with the application, which in turn interacts. The llc and mac sub layers allow for different layer 2 protocols to be used, such as ethernet, token ring and fddi. About osi, tcpip layers and protocols amcat osi, tcpip layers and protocols questions.
1075 873 614 911 298 894 109 1171 996 782 522 356 54 829 765 292 144 1413 578 617 1347 977 893 1459 1031 1091 200 652 465